Embodiment 1

[0016] Weigh 100kg of polypropylene, 30kg of 3000 mesh barium sulfate, 10kg of POE, 0.25kg of bis(p-phenylenedibenzylidene)sorbitol, 0.15kg of antioxidant 1010, 0.15kg of antioxidant 168, 0.20kg of EBS, Add the above-mentioned weighed ingredients into the high-mixing pot, stir for 30 minutes, so that the components are fully dispersed to obtain a mixture; After drying at ℃ for 3 hours, a high-gloss polypropylene material is obtained.

Embodiment 2

[0018] Weigh 100kg of polypropylene, 20kg of barium sulfate of 3000 mesh, POE5kg, 0.1kg of bis(p-phenylenedibenzylidene)sorbitol, 0.10kg of antioxidant 1010, 0.10kg of antioxidant 168, 0.10kg of EBS, Then according to the preparation method described in Example 1, a high-gloss polypropylene material was prepared.

Embodiment 3

[0020] Weigh 100kg of polypropylene, 35kg of 3000 mesh barium sulfate, 20kg of POE, 0.30kg of bis(p-phenylenedibenzylidene)sorbitol, 0.20kg of antioxidant 1010, 0.20kg of antioxidant 168, 0.30kg of EBS, Then according to the preparation method described in Example 1, a high-gloss polypropylene material was prepared.

Abstract

The invention provides a high-gloss polypropylene material which is characterized by being obtained by physical modification and comprising the following components: 100 parts of polypropylene, 20-35 parts of barium sulfate, 5-20 parts of POE (polyolefin elastomer), 0.1-0.4 part of nucleating agent, 0.1-0.2 part of antioxidant 1010, 0.1-0.2 part of antioxidant 168 and 0.1-0.3 part of lubricant. The modified PP aggregates have low forming shrinkage, high gloss and high toughness and have the advantage of elegant and attractive appearance of acrylonitrile butadiene styrene. Meanwhile, the cost is greatly reduced.

Description

technical field [0001] The invention relates to the field of polypropylene (PP) modification, in particular to a high-gloss polypropylene material that improves the gloss and toughness of PP and reduces the shrinkage of PP through modification of PP. Background technique [0002] The adjustment frame of the infusion set is generally made of ABS or PP injection molding. High-end and precision infusion sets use ABS as the adjustment frame, because the adjustment frame of the ABS injection molding is generous and beautiful, the flow rate is adjusted accurately, and the gloss is good, but the cost is relatively expensive; and Ordinary PP injection molding adjustment frame has low gloss and poor toughness. [0003] Polypropylene is currently the second most used general-purpose plastic. It has excellent comprehensive properties, stable chemical properties, good molding and processing performance, and low price.
